lns命令linux是什么意思

fiy 其他 23

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    lns命令是Linux系统中的一个命令,它用于创建链接(link)。链接也被称为符号链接或软链接,它是一个指向另一个文件或目录的特殊文件。通过创建链接,我们可以在不改变文件或目录的位置的情况下,在不同的位置引用它。

    lns命令的语法如下:
    ln -s [源文件或目录] [链接文件]

    其中,-s选项用于创建符号链接。源文件或目录是我们想要创建链接的文件或目录的路径。链接文件是我们要创建的链接的路径。

    lns命令的一些常用示例:
    1. 创建一个文件链接:
    lns -s /path/to/sourcefile /path/to/linkfile
    该命令会在/path/to目录中创建一个名为linkfile的链接,该链接指向/sourcefile。

    2. 创建一个目录链接:
    lns -s /path/to/sourcedir /path/to/linkdir
    该命令会在/path/to目录中创建一个名为linkdir的链接,该链接指向/sourcedir。

    3. 创建一个链接到当前目录的链接:
    lns -s /path/to/sourcefile linkfile
    该命令会在当前目录中创建一个名为linkfile的链接,该链接指向/path/to/sourcefile。

    需要注意的是,创建链接时需要确保源文件或目录存在,链接文件不存在,并且链接文件的上级目录已经存在。此外,符号链接只是源文件或目录的引用,如果源文件或目录被删除,链接将会失效。

    总结:
    lns命令是Linux系统中用于创建符号链接的命令。通过创建链接,我们可以在不改变文件或目录位置的情况下,在不同的位置引用它。使用lns命令可以方便地创建文件链接和目录链接。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    lns命令在Linux系统中是一个用于创建链接的命令。lns的全称是”link source”,它的作用是创建一个指向目标文件或目录的链接。

    1. 创建硬链接:lns命令可以创建硬链接。硬链接是指多个文件名指向同一物理文件的情况。当你删除一个硬链接时,其他链接和物理文件本身仍然存在。创建硬链接的命令格式是:lns 源文件 目标文件。

    2. 创建软链接:lns命令也可以创建软链接,也被称为符号链接或快捷方式。软链接是一个特殊的文件,它引用另一个文件或目录。当你删除一个软链接时,物理文件本身不会受影响。创建软链接的命令格式是:lns -s 源文件 目标文件。

    3. 默认情况下,lns命令创建硬链接。这意味着,当你创建一个硬链接时,源文件和目标文件将指向同一个物理文件。如果你修改了其中一个链接的内容,其他链接和物理文件也会被影响,因为它们共享相同的inode和数据块。

    4. 软链接则不同,它们是指向源文件或目录的路径名的符号链接。当你访问软链接时,实际上是访问原始文件或目录。软链接允许你创建对其他目录或文件的引用,甚至可以跨越不同的文件系统。

    5. lns命令还有一些选项可以用于修改其行为,比如-f用于覆盖已存在的目标文件,-i用于在覆盖已存在的目标文件之前进行提示。你可以通过man lns命令来查看lns命令的所有选项和使用示例。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    lns命令是Linux系统中的一个命令,用于创建链接(link)。

    链接是指向文件或目录的引用,可以通过不同的链接方式来引用原始文件或目录。在Linux系统中,主要有两种类型的链接:硬链接和符号链接(也称为软链接)。硬链接是指不同的文件名指向同一个文件的不同位置,而符号链接是一个特殊类型的文件,它包含了指向另一个文件或目录的路径。

    lns命令的主要作用是创建符号链接。可以将一个已经存在的文件或目录链接到另一个位置,从而可以在不同的路径下访问同一个文件或目录。lns命令的使用方法如下:

    lns [options] 原始文件 目标文件

    其中,原始文件是要创建链接的文件或目录的路径,目标文件是链接的名称或路径。

    例如,假设当前目录下有一个文件hello.txt,我们希望在当前目录下创建一个名为link.txt的符号链接,指向hello.txt文件,可以使用以下命令:

    lns hello.txt link.txt

    lns命令的一些常用选项如下:

    -s:创建符号链接。默认情况下,lns命令会创建硬链接,使用-s选项可以创建符号链接。
    -f:如果目标文件已经存在,则强制删除它后再创建链接。
    -d:如果原始文件是一个目录,则创建目录的链接,而不是目录下的内容的链接。
    -i:在创建链接之前,给出提示是否覆盖已经存在的文件。

    除了创建链接,lns命令还可以使用其他选项来修改链接的属性、更改链接的目标等操作。

    总结起来,lns命令是Linux系统中用于创建符号链接的命令,它可以将一个已经存在的文件或目录链接到另一个位置,从而可以在不同的路径下访问同一个文件或目录。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部